Overview
The LTC2622CMS8#PBF is a dual 12-bit rail-to-rail voltage-output digital-to-analog converter (DAC) manufactured by Analog Devices Inc. It operates on a single supply voltage ranging from 2.5V to 5.5V and is housed in an 8-lead MSOP package. The device features built-in high-performance output buffers capable of sourcing or sinking up to 15mA, ensuring guaranteed monotonicity over the operating temperature range. It utilizes a simple SPI/Microwire compatible 3-wire serial interface with clock rates up to 50MHz. Key electrical specifications include a settling time of 7µs for ±1LSB accuracy at 12 bits, differential nonlinearity (DNL) of ±0.5 LSB, and integral nonlinearity (INL) of ±0.75 LSB.

Selection Notes
Select the LTC2622 when dual 12-bit precision is required in a compact footprint. Compare against the LTC2602 (16-bit) or LTC2612 (14-bit) if higher resolution is needed within the same pinout. Consider power-down modes for battery-operated applications to reduce current consumption. Verify that the 2.5V to 5.5V supply range matches system requirements.
Part Context
This component belongs to the LTC2602/LTC2612/LTC2622 family of dual DACs. The CMS8 suffix indicates the commercial temperature range (0°C to 70°C) and the MSOP-8 package type. The #PBF suffix denotes lead-free packaging compliant with RoHS standards. It shares pin compatibility with other members of the series and the LTC1661.
Replacement Considerations
Pin-compatible alternatives within the same family include the LTC2602CMS8#PBF (16-bit) and LTC2612CMS8#PBF (14-bit). For lower resolution needs, the LTC1661CMS8#PBF (10-bit) offers similar form factors. Verify interface compatibility and performance parameters before substitution.
